Quote: What do you mean by tough coin? It's a key date, an extremely low mintage. Yours is a Type Two, where FIVE CENTS is recessed below the straight line of the mound in which the buffalo sits. Type One coins have that whole mound present - no line - and FIVE CENTS was on the mound, where it wore off almost immediately. That's why they went to the Type Two design. It's like this: combined, 1913-S Type One and Type Twos together are the 7th-smallest Buffalo mintage. Individually, they're tough to find. The coin you've posted is worth in excess of $100.
